Default will a b17 (92-93 gsr) header fit a b18a/b (90-93) LS motor?

as the question states.....sorry for the lame post, but the search wasnt cooperating. i need to know what's different if anything......header flange fitment, oil pan clearance, oxygen sensor location, exhaust flange differences (if any)?...i've never seen or installed a b17 header for that matter, so i'm not sure of the differences.

one other thing.... i'm pretty sure its a 1990 b18a1 it will go on.... its in an 88' civic swap...sorry, but its for a friend who found a great deal on a b17 header and he wants to buy, so i need to confirm for him that it fits..... (he doesnt know jack about hondas). info on compatibility for the b18a1 and b18b motors would be greatly appreciated.

p.s. i am aware of the clearance issues for headers on EF swaps, i just need to know if a b17 header will bolt up to a b18a/b motor without problems.....any help is appreciated, thanks guys

yes! all b-series header bolt up to any b-series head. its just the collector lenth that is different by car. no matter if its a b16, b17, b18, or b20.

And as for the o2 ssensor location, its on the end of the collector if its obd1, and its on the top of the the header if its obd0.
